Setmore
Setmore was founded in 2011 and acquired by Full Creative in 2018. The product is best known for its long-running free plan, which historically included up to four staff calendars and made it a popular pick for small clinics, tutors, freelancers, and side-hustle service businesses. Core features include staff scheduling, recurring appointments, automated email reminders, a free booking page, and the in-house Teleport video meeting tool, with Zoom and Google Meet available on paid plans. Setmore integrates with Square, Stripe, Mailchimp, Zoho CRM, and Zapier. The interface has been refreshed over the years but still feels older than newer entrants, and SMS reminders are paid add-ons.

What does SchedulingKit cost compared to Setmore?
SchedulingKit pricing: Free / $10-25/month. Setmore pricing: Free / $12-36/seat/month. Watch for extras — SMS reminders, payment processing, and additional team seats often add 30-50% to headline prices on both platforms.
